While I like the style, I think the layouts could be improved. Make sure the character sticks out from the BG (the driver in the car does not).
And the movements could do with a lot more dynamics. Skip that motion blur, you don't need it. Do faster movements and pauses with no movements in a nice rhythm. Also the camera zooms don't really make a point.

I was worried about over developing the back grounds but one approach I took was to not use out lines on the back grounds. The characters are the only thing with outlines. I felt this would help pop the characters out better. The movements do need better development. Thanks for the great advice, I will be utilizing these to improve this.
